Transaction fc3f1752214ab23d4541d1e8a42e068e891ad4d2d36e74349c2d687a1f4d7a63
1 Input
1 Output
-
fc3f1752214ab23d4541d1e8a42e068e891ad4d2d36e74349c2d687a1f4d7a63:0
- value
- 902429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f51f6e3d1421af2573b098d4be80a6129a503b15 OP_EQUAL
- address
- 3Q378NzMHxhvLgRR9t3NuXp5opTJS59jfm